Build your own motorized custom camera slider from scratch for around $75

Camera sliders are one of the easiest ways to add interesting motion to your timelapse and video sequences, but many of the commercial options are still extremely expensive. How to light up a green screen for a perfect key and seamless compositing

Setting up a green screen to record footage of a subject that will be cut out and composited into another background has become commonplace these days.  What is ultimately a pretty straightforward process, however, can be a difficult one to learn. LandscapePro promises to do to turn your dull boring images into dramatic landscapes

Anthropics, the creators of PortraitPro, have set their sights on a new target with the launch of their new LandscapePro standalone application and Photoshop plugin.
